Options for backing up Enterprise Scanner
Use the Backup and Recovery page to manage snapshots of configuration settings and to create complete system backups.
Types of backups
Settings backup
A settings backup is a snapshot file that stores all of your appliance configuration settings. You can have many settings snapshot files of different configurations.
Full backup
A full backup stores a complete image of the operating system and current configuration settings of the appliance. You can have only one system backup file. When you restore from a system backup, you restore the appliance to a previous state. Is this still valid for 2.4 agents?

If you restore a system before you make backups
The default system backup for a new appliance contains the original installation. If you restore a system backup or apply settings snapshot files before you create your own backup files, you are restoring the appliance to its installation defaults. The following consequences result:
vYou lose the configuration settings you have already applied.
vIf you restore from a system backup, you lose any updates you have already applied.
Important: You must reconfigure the agent starting with running the Proventia Setup Assistant. (The configuration process is described in the IBM Proventia Network Enterprise Scanner Getting Started Guide.)
vYou must reconfigure the appliance starting with running the Setup Assistant.
vYou cannot access Proventia Manager until you reconfigure the appliance.
Important: Follow the recommended backup procedures to avoid having to reconfigure your agent in case of an emergency.
Date of last system backup
The System Status information about the Home page includes the date of the last backup in the Last System Backup field.
